The Three Pillars of Google Business Profile SEO
To dominate the local landscape, we must first understand the technical framework Google uses to evaluate your business. When we perform google business profile seo, we are optimizing for three specific variables that Google’s local algorithm weighs against every search query.
- Relevance: This measures how well your local listing matches what someone is searching for. If you are a “Houston HVAC Contractor” but your profile only mentions “AC Repair,” you might miss out on broader searches. Relevance is built through meticulous category selection, detailed service descriptions, and ensuring your google business profile seo strategy aligns with the actual language your customers use.
- Distance (Proximity): This is the distance of each potential search result from the location term used in a search. If a user doesn’t specify a location (e.g., just searching “plumber”), Google calculates distance based on what it knows about the user’s location. As established, this is the factor you have the least control over.
- Prominence (Authority): This is the most critical factor for long-term success. Prominence refers to how well-known a business is. This is based on information that Google has about a business from across the web, such as links, articles, and directories. Prominence also includes your position in web search results, which is why traditional SEO and local SEO are now inextricably linked.
Because Houston is a sprawling metropolis, the “Distance” factor is often neutralized by the sheer number of options. Therefore, the battle for the 3-Pack is won or lost on Relevance and Prominence. Unstructured Citations vs. Standard Directories
For years, local seo services focused heavily on “NAP” (Name, Address, Phone Number) consistency across directories like Yelp and Yellow Pages. While this is still a baseline requirement, the value of standard directory citations has diminished. Today, “unstructured mentions” carry more weight. An unstructured citation is a mention of your business on a news site, a local blog, or a community forum that doesn’t follow a standard directory format. These mentions are harder to get and therefore more valuable to Google. They prove that people are actually talking about your business in a Houston context.

The Role of Reviews and Engagement in Local Brand Authority
Reviews are often viewed as a “social proof” tool for customers, but for a google business profile ranking, they are a massive data source. Google doesn’t just look at your star rating; it analyzes the *velocity* (how often you get reviews) and the *content* of those reviews.
In Houston, geo-relevance is key. When a customer leaves a review and says, “The best AC repair team in The Heights,” or “They arrived quickly at my office in Sugar Land,” they are providing Google with localized keywords that tie your authority to specific geographic sub-markets. Encouraging your customers to be specific about the service they received and the neighborhood they are in can significantly boost your prominence in those specific areas.
Furthermore, engagement matters. If users are frequently clicking “Call,” “Directions,” or “Website” on your profile, Google sees that as a signal that your business is prominent and relevant. This creates a virtuous cycle: higher authority leads to more engagement, which leads to even higher rankings in the local map pack seo results.
